The Resilience Formula

Anyone can argue the accuracy of the Millions and Billions now purported spent each year by business and healthcare on stress-related illnesses and workplace absenteeism. Nevertheless, whatever the correct number is it's BIG! and it is, in the Billions!

In a new global economy where every cent is crucial to corporate survival, governments and business can no longer afford to ignore this costly and ever-growing crisis.

The phrase Employee Burnout is common in this new millennium's lexicon. Sadly, so is the phrase Long-Term Disability. What can be done about this?

Whether it's stress on the job, at home or a combination of both, most everyone understands and accepts that responsibility and stress are simply a fact of life. What most people do not recognize, however, are important things like:

-What exactly causes personal stress and how it diminishes their quality of life,

-The [predictable] physiological and social, negative outcomes from uncontrolled stress, and

-The significance of learned Resilience and its relationship to Peak Performance!

Psychologists tell us that behavior of any kind - positive or negative - is learned through repetition. Learning to be more resilient is every bit as behavioral as learning to succeed. It is an integral ingredient for health, wellness and peak performance.

As one learns to Recognize the unfeigned motivations for their stress and imbalance, so too can they learn to Respond with strategic tools, designed to minimize the destructive aspects of stress. Breathing exercises, energy-management methods, psychological behavioral-triggers and priority-listing techniques are all integral parts of a proven Resilience Formula that teaches people ways to re-galvanize their time, focus and energy. It ensures an enhanced quality of life whilst saving business and healthcare, money.
